>>>>> I'll admit that it's odd that listen can fail in that instance, but my
>>>>> guess is that it's some sort of race due to running multiple copies of
>>>>> M5 and both of them trying to bind the same port. That said, you
>>>>> haven't posted enough information to debug the problem. i.e. what's
>>>>> the stack trace at the panic? Another thing to do would be to add
>>>>> strerror(errno) to the panic message. In reality, it should work just
>>>>> fine to return failure instead of invoking panic in that instance.
